Output ef306c8dcbc01f106b62b0a921f40fa167fb01bb45ca3fc2f5adf43f8dcf04e9:1

value
26526
script pubkey
OP_0 OP_PUSHBYTES_20 8cf7688618a0fdc714223530f14d1bf89056aa10
address
bc1q3nmk3psc5r7uw9pzx5c0zngmlzg9d2ssx6l7jc
transaction
ef306c8dcbc01f106b62b0a921f40fa167fb01bb45ca3fc2f5adf43f8dcf04e9
confirmations
6147
spent
true